Output 291615e814068c1c815b4b6da9c14048dfdea5da7444390f497f01d530209a2f:6

value
48509024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908b79c5b1842df12d71cdc4ea2e835ae3e7b3c0 OP_EQUAL
address
3EsJK7A7jAoVw2H8cuGyzhLAfAWEKqZxSh
transaction
291615e814068c1c815b4b6da9c14048dfdea5da7444390f497f01d530209a2f
spent
true